The Cartwheel
Easily missed, as it resembles a pair of red-brick cottages, the Cartwheel comprises a pleasant bar with low ceiling and a log fire, plus a dining room where good food is served every day. Pictures show the local racing stables - indeed the pub was re-opened by Desert Orchid in 2004. This remote and immaculately preserved part of Hampshire is ideal walking country, but the only public transport is the bookable C61 bus service from Fordingbridge.
